Improving engine throttle response on sport touring motorcycles can significantly enhance your riding experience, offering smoother acceleration and better control. Whether you're navigating twisty backroads or cruising on the highway, refined throttle response makes your bike more responsive and enjoyable.

Key Ways to Enhance Throttle Response

  • Adjust the Throttle Cables: Ensure your throttle cables are properly lubricated and free of slack. Tightening loose cables reduces delay when you twist the throttle.
  • Upgrade the Air Filter: A high-flow air filter improves airflow to the engine, allowing it to breathe better and respond more quickly.
  • Optimize Fuel Delivery: Consider installing a fuel controller or remapping your ECU to fine-tune the air-fuel mixture, which can lead to sharper throttle response.
  • Regular Maintenance: Clean or replace spark plugs, check for clogged injectors, and maintain your exhaust system to keep the engine running smoothly.
  • Use Quality Fuel: Premium fuels can burn cleaner and provide better combustion, contributing to improved throttle feel.

Additional Tips for Sport Touring Riders

Sport touring motorcycles balance performance and comfort, so any modifications should maintain this harmony. Avoid overly aggressive tuning that sacrifices reliability or fuel economy. Instead, aim for incremental improvements and always test ride after adjustments to find the best setup for your riding style.
